[QUOTE="1894, post: 18771, member: 1958"] Petander, If it's not too late you need to take a REAL careful look through that scope at higher than 16 power. Both mine and a friends were extremely unclear over 16 power, so much so that I sold mine and he stays at 16x or lower. I am a lifelong Swarovski fan having 6 of them but the 6-24 is IMHO very poor opticaly over 16 power which makes it a rather pointless scope. [/QUOTE]
